				Overview:

CORT Events provides furniture rental solutions to trade shows and events including festivals, weddings, corporate events, or even the Superbowl!  The Tradeshow Site Manager works collaboratively as a part of our operations team; successfully leads and supports deliverables at show site in accordance with CORT Safety standards and required delivery and/or pick up expectations by event or show. The Tradeshow Site Manager supports Customer Service goals and acts as the liaison between the District Service Representatives and Operations.

Pay: $58,000 / year. This position is also eligible for CORT's Performance Sharing Plan (PSP) bonus plan.

Schedule: Schedule for this position will vary based on business needs and will regularly include nights, Saturdays, and Sundays. These shifts are an essential and expected part of the role.
